How Smart Thermostats Function

At their core, a smart thermostat operates similarly to a conventional thermostat but adds a layer of intelligence and connectivity. They use sensors to measure the ambient temperature and adjust the heating or cooling system accordingly. What sets them apart is their ability to connect to your home’s Wi-Fi network, allowing for remote control and data analysis. This connectivity unlocks a range of features, from setting schedules to monitoring energy usage. These devices interact directly with your boiler or heating system, intelligently responding to environmental changes and user preferences.

  • Connectivity: The ability to connect to your home network, allowing remote control and integration with other smart home devices.
  • Connectivity is the cornerstone of a smart thermostat’s functionality. It allows you to adjust the temperature from anywhere using your smartphone, tablet, or computer. This feature is particularly useful if you are away from home or want to preheat your house before you arrive. This also enables the thermostat to receive software updates and integrate with other smart home systems, creating a cohesive and connected home environment.

  • Learning Capabilities: Algorithms that learn your habits and adjust the temperature automatically, optimizing for comfort and energy savings.
  • Smart thermostats utilize algorithms to learn your heating and cooling preferences. They analyze your daily routines and adjust the temperature accordingly. For instance, if you usually wake up at 7 am, the thermostat will gradually increase the temperature before that time. This feature eliminates the need for manual adjustments and helps save energy by avoiding unnecessary heating or cooling when the home is unoccupied. The more it’s used, the better it becomes at anticipating your needs.

  • Scheduling: The capability to set detailed heating and cooling schedules, allowing you to tailor the temperature to your lifestyle.
  • Scheduling is a key feature of smart thermostats. They allow you to create custom heating and cooling schedules based on your daily or weekly routines. You can set different temperatures for different times of the day or week. For example, you can lower the temperature when you are at work and increase it before you return home. This level of customization ensures that you have the desired comfort at the right time, minimizing energy waste.

Energy-Saving Features

Smart thermostats incorporate various features designed to minimize energy consumption and reduce your utility bills. These features work in conjunction to provide optimal heating and cooling performance while maximizing savings. From learning your preferences to automatically adjusting the temperature when you are away from home, these features make it easier to conserve energy without sacrificing comfort.

  • Geofencing: Using your location to automatically adjust the temperature when you leave or arrive at home.
  • Geofencing allows your smart thermostat to know when you’re away from home. When you leave, the thermostat can automatically lower the temperature, reducing energy consumption. As you approach home, the thermostat starts heating or cooling to ensure a comfortable environment upon your return. This feature eliminates the need to manually adjust the thermostat and helps to avoid wasting energy when your home is unoccupied. It’s especially useful for those with irregular schedules.

  • Usage Reports: Providing detailed insights into your energy consumption, allowing you to monitor and adjust your heating and cooling habits.
  • Smart thermostats provide detailed reports on your energy consumption, enabling you to see how much energy you use over time. These reports often show how your usage changes based on your schedule, weather conditions, and other factors. By analyzing these reports, you can identify areas where you can further reduce your energy consumption. It is important to compare your usage to previous months or years to assess the effectiveness of your smart thermostat and any adjustments you make.

  • Automatic Adjustments: Automatically adjusting the temperature based on factors such as weather conditions and occupancy.
  • Smart thermostats can use weather data to automatically adjust your heating and cooling. For instance, on a sunny day, the thermostat might reduce heating to take advantage of solar gain. Some models also detect occupancy using sensors and adjust the temperature to prevent heating or cooling empty rooms. This automation further improves energy efficiency by ensuring that the system only operates when and where it is needed.

Compatibility and Connectivity

The ability of a smart thermostat to connect with other smart devices relies on compatibility and connectivity protocols. Most smart thermostats use Wi-Fi to connect to your home network, enabling them to communicate with other devices. The specific protocols supported by the thermostat will determine which other devices it can communicate with, ensuring a well-integrated smart home setup.

  • Wi-Fi: Connecting to your home’s Wi-Fi network, enabling remote control and communication with other smart devices.
  • Wi-Fi connectivity is essential for smart thermostats. It allows you to control your thermostat from anywhere using a smartphone, tablet, or computer. This connectivity also enables integration with other smart home devices that use the same network. This is important for receiving over-the-air updates, which enhance the functionality of the thermostat and allow access to new features. A strong Wi-Fi signal is important to ensure consistent and reliable performance.

  • Smart Home Platforms: Integration with platforms such as Amazon Alexa, Google Assistant, and Apple HomeKit, enabling voice control and automation.
  • Many smart thermostats are compatible with popular smart home platforms such as Amazon Alexa, Google Assistant, and Apple HomeKit. This integration allows you to control your thermostat using voice commands and create automated routines that work with other smart home devices. For example, you could set up a routine that automatically turns off the lights and lowers the temperature when you say, “Good night”. Compatibility with these platforms is also important for creating a unified smart home experience, where all your devices work together seamlessly.

  • API Integration: Support for APIs (Application Programming Interfaces) allowing the thermostat to connect with various smart home services and devices.
  • API integration allows advanced users and developers to connect their smart thermostats to various smart home services and devices. This is important for custom integrations and advanced automation. It lets you create custom scripts and automation rules that extend the functionality of the thermostat beyond what the manufacturer intended. This enables greater personalization and more in-depth integration with other smart home systems. It also allows your smart thermostat to interact with third-party applications and services, increasing its versatility.

Frequently Asked Questions

Question: How much money can I actually save with a smart thermostat?

Answer: Savings vary based on usage, home size, and energy prices. However, many users report saving 10-20% on their energy bills.

Question: Can I control the smart thermostat remotely when I am away from home?

Answer: Yes, the primary advantage of a smart thermostat is the ability to control it remotely via a smartphone app or web interface.

Question: Is it difficult to install a smart thermostat myself?

Answer: Most smart thermostats are designed for easy installation and come with detailed instructions. You can typically replace your old thermostat yourself.

Question: Does a smart thermostat work with my boiler?

Answer: Most smart thermostats work with standard UK boilers, but it is important to confirm compatibility before purchasing.

Question: Are smart thermostats secure?

Answer: Yes, reputable smart thermostats use security measures like encryption to protect user data and prevent unauthorized access.
